[[File:Tls certificates client gen p1.png|border|class=tlt-border|860px]
[[File:Tls certificates client gen p1.png|border|class=tlt-border|860px]]
[[File:Tls certificates client gen p1.png|border|class=tlt-border|860px]]
+
====Generation of DH Parameters====
+
----
+
The '''DH parameter''' refers to the parameters used in the Diffie-Hellman key exchange. This cryptographic protocol allows two parties to securely generate a shared secret over an untrusted communication channel. In practical use, such as with VPNs, TLS/SSL, or routers, DH parameters are used to securely generate session keys for encrypting data. Generating a server certificate follows similar steps: